Position Summary

The Social Media Content Creator creates engaging content to share on various social media platforms for the purposes of recruitment and marketing, such as Facebook, Instagram, and Tik Tok. Attends various events and functions at the college to take photographs and video for the purpose of content creation. Collaborate with BMCC programs and departments to create content. Stays up to date on current social trends on multiple platforms. Creates a variety of content on a regular basis to develop an archive of ready-to-use media to post to social media. Performs all functions and activities within the guidelines and philosophy set forth in the BMCC Mission, Vision and Strategic Plan.

Essential Functions

  • Responsible for the creation of content to use on social media platforms.
  • Attends events and functions on campus to take photographs and video.
  • Works with programs and departments to create content related to their programs.
  • Capture photographs and videos to illustrate campus life.
  • Updates bulletin boards across campus including posting approved posters and removing expired postings.
  • Collaborates with BMCC Ambassadors and Associated Student Government for content.
  • Keeps BMCC involved in current trends.
  • Understand and discover trending social content and apply to the BMCC brand.
  • Maintain sensitivity, understanding, and respect for a diverse academic environment, inclusive of students, faculty and staff of varying social, economic, cultural, ideological and ethnic backgrounds.

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ities

Individuals must possess the following knowledge, skills, and abilities or be able to explain and demonstrate that the individual can perform the essential functions of the job, with or without reasonable accommodation, using some other combination of skills and abilities:

  • Knowledge and/or experience in various social media platforms including Facebook, Tik Tok, Instagram, and Twitter.
  • Working knowledge/proficiency with photo and video editing software.
  • Excellent skills in editing various types of digital content ranging from general text content to specialized video content.
  • Ability to create and edit images using software tools such as Adobe Photoshop, Adobe Illustrator and/or Adobe InDesign.
  • Strong attention to detail, accuracy, accountability and deadlines, with excellent organizational, time-management, and multi-tasking abilities.
  • Organized, reliable self-starter with strong creative thinking and collaboration skills.
  • Ability to learn new trends, set priorities, and work effectively and efficiently under deadlines.
  • Ability to work independently with regular supervision, follow detailed directions and complete assigned tasks.
  • Ability to work cooperatively as a team member with strong interpersonal, written, and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with staff and students and deliver outstanding customer service.
  • Ability and willingness to work within established department and institutional guidelines, priorities, and schedules.
